The Cocaine Bear trailer has been making rounds on the internet since its release. What many people don't know about the movie is that it's based on a true story. Of course, the cinema embellishes it a ton. But it is a true story.
In 1985 Andrew Thornton, paranoid and on the run, ditched his plane during a drug run and fell to his death in the Appalachian mountains. Thornton broke bad after a career as an undercover officer and started running Cocaine from South America across the US. The night he died, he was transporting thousands of pounds of Cocaine. A bear then consumed that Cocaine. The bear went on a rampage in the movie, which didn't happen. But the bear is now a Kentucky icon.
